好程序員雲計算教程分享Mysql技術知識點,首先來講一下Mysql語句精進
安裝數據庫,然後導入tigerfive.sql。 sql見文檔結尾部分
MySQL示例數據庫模式由以下表組成:
- customers: 存儲客戶的數據。
- products: 存儲汽車的數據。
- productLines: 存儲產品類別數據。
- orders: 存儲客戶訂購的銷售訂單。
- orderDetails: 存儲每個銷售訂單的訂單產品數據項。
- payments: 存儲客戶訂單的付款數據信息。
- employees: 存儲所有員工信息以及組織結構,例如,直接上級(誰向誰報告工作)。
- offices: 存儲銷售處數據,類似於各個分公司
表關係如下:
SQL語句分類:
SQL語句主要分爲三大類
DDL語句
DDL是數據定義語句,是對數據庫內部的對象進行創建、刪除、修改等操作的語句.create、drop、alter等(DBA常用)
DML語句
DML是數據操作語句,指對數據庫表記錄的基本操作,insert、update、delete、select等(開發常用)
DCL語句
DCL是數據控制語句,用於控制不同數據段直接的許可和訪問級別的語句.定義了數據庫、表、字段、用戶的訪問權限和安全級別.主要是grant、revoke等(DBA常用)
數據庫基本操作
數據庫的增刪改查
庫操作
創建庫
mysql > create database db1;
查看庫
mysql > show databases;
mysql > show create database db1; //更詳細的查看庫
使用庫
mysql > use db1;
段'='' ;
表操作
創建表
mysql > create tables 表名(字段 類型(修飾符))
查看錶
查看所有表:mysql > show tables ;
查看錶記錄:mysql > show table status like '表名' ;
查看錶結構:mysql > desc '表名' ;
查看錶記錄:mysql > select * from '表名' limit 10;
修改表
修改表名:mysql > rename table '源表名' to '新表名' ;
字段記錄操作
字段
添加字段:mysql > alter table '表名' add '字段' '修飾符';
刪除字段:mysql > alter table '表名' drop '字段' ;
修改字段:mysql > alter table '表名' change '舊字段' '新字段' '修飾符';
記錄
添加記錄:insert into '表名(記錄,記錄)' values (),(),();
:insert into '表名' values (),(),();
修改記錄:update '表名' set 字段='' where 字段='';
刪除記錄:delete from '表名' where '字